Types of Laminate Adhesives Available in the Market

There are various types of laminate adhesives available in the market, each catering to specific needs and applications. One common type is solvent-based adhesive, which provides a strong bond but may emit volatile organic compounds (VOCs). Water-based adhesives are another popular option known for their eco-friendly nature and low VOC emissions, making them suitable for indoor applications. Additionally, hot melt adhesives offer quick bonding and are often used in high-speed production environments due to their fast setting time.

Furthermore, pressure-sensitive adhesives are widely used in the laminate market for their ease of application and repositioning capabilities. These adhesives create a strong bond upon application of pressure and are commonly used in applications like flooring and decorative laminates. Additionally, reactive adhesives require a chemical reaction to bond surfaces together, providing a durable and long-lasting bond. Each type of laminate adhesive has its advantages and considerations, making it essential to choose the most suitable one based on the specific requirements of the project.

Applications of Laminate Adhesive in Various Industries

Laminate adhesive plays a pivotal role in various industries due to its versatile applications. The furniture market extensively relies on laminate adhesive for bonding decorative laminates to substrates, providing aesthetic finishes to furniture pieces. Moreover, in the automotive sector, laminate adhesive is essential for affixing interior trim components, ensuring durability and enhancing the overall aesthetic appeal of vehicles.

In the construction market, laminate adhesive is indispensable for bonding laminates to surfaces, such as countertops, cabinets, and flooring, offering both functional and aesthetic benefits. Additionally, the packaging market utilizes laminate adhesives for creating laminated packaging materials that offer barrier protection, visual appeal, and enhanced durability. The diverse applications of laminate adhesive across different industries underscore its significance as a key component in enhancing product quality and performance.

Innovations Driving Growth in the Laminate Adhesive Market

One notable innovation driving growth in the laminate adhesive market is the development of solvent-free adhesive formulations. These eco-friendly adhesives eliminate the need for harmful chemicals, making them more appealing to environmentally conscious consumers. Additionally, solvent-free adhesives offer improved performance characteristics, such as faster curing times and increased bond strength, making them a preferred choice for various applications in industries like construction and furniture manufacturing.

Another significant advancement in the laminate adhesive market is the introduction of moisture-curing adhesives. These adhesives are designed to cure in the presence of moisture, offering unmatched bonding capabilities in humid environments. With the ability to withstand moisture and temperature variations, moisture-curing adhesives are becoming increasingly popular for outdoor applications like laminating exterior building panels and flooring installations. As manufacturers continue to invest in research and development to enhance the properties of these adhesives, the market is poised for substantial growth in the coming years.
